Tests de disponibilité pour les réseaux de diffusion de contenu (CDN)
Les tests de disponibilité pour les réseaux de distribution de contenu (CDN) sont conçus pour garantir que votre CDN reste hautement disponible et réactif sous diverses conditions de charge. En utilisant <a href="https://loadfocus.com/load-testing">LoadFocus Load Testing Tool/Service</a>, vous pouvez simuler des milliers d'utilisateurs virtuels concurrents provenant de plus de 26 régions cloud, testant la capacité de votre CDN à livrer du contenu avec une haute disponibilité et un minimum de temps d'arrêt, même pendant les périodes de trafic de pointe.
Qu'est-ce que le test de disponibilité pour les CDN ?
Le test de disponibilité pour les réseaux de distribution de contenu (CDN) se concentre sur l'évaluation de la fiabilité et de la disponibilité de votre CDN dans différentes conditions de trafic. Ce modèle vous permet de simuler un trafic à fort volume et de tester comment votre CDN fonctionne sous charge. En utilisant LoadFocus (Service de test de charge LoadFocus), vous pouvez effectuer des tests avec des milliers d'utilisateurs simultanés dans plus de 26 régions cloud, garantissant que votre CDN livre du contenu de manière efficace et sans temps d'arrêt, même sous pression.
Ce modèle vous guidera à travers les étapes de configuration, d'exécution et d'analyse des tests de disponibilité pour votre CDN, vous aidant à maintenir des performances optimales pendant les périodes de forte utilisation.
Comment ce modèle aide-t-il ?
Notre modèle vous aide à identifier toute interruption potentielle ou dégradation des performances de votre CDN en simulant des modèles de trafic du monde réel. Il vous guide dans la configuration de tests qui répliquent des scénarios d'utilisation typiques et de pointe, vous donnant des informations sur la capacité de votre CDN à évoluer et à maintenir une haute disponibilité.
Pourquoi avons-nous besoin de tests de disponibilité pour les CDN ?
Sans tests de disponibilité appropriés, votre CDN peut rencontrer des problèmes de performance, tels que la latence ou des temps d'arrêt, pendant les périodes de forte demande. Ce modèle garantit que votre CDN peut supporter un trafic important, rester hautement disponible et livrer du contenu rapidement sans interruptions, améliorant ainsi la fiabilité de votre site et l'expérience utilisateur.
- Tester la disponibilité du CDN : Assurez-vous que votre CDN reste accessible et fiable pendant les pics de trafic.
- Minimiser les temps d'arrêt : Détecter et résoudre proactivement les problèmes qui pourraient causer des interruptions de service.
- Améliorer l'expérience utilisateur : Améliorez les temps de chargement des pages et assurez une livraison de contenu de haute qualité même pendant les périodes de forte demande.
Comment fonctionne le test de disponibilité pour les CDN
Ce modèle définit comment simuler des charges de trafic à grande échelle pour évaluer la performance et la disponibilité de votre CDN. En utilisant les outils LoadFocus, vous pouvez configurer des tests qui reflètent avec précision à la fois la charge utilisateur moyenne et extrême, vous permettant de suivre les performances et la disponibilité sous stress.
Les bases de ce modèle
Le modèle comprend une variété de scénarios d'échec, de stratégies de surveillance et de métriques clés. LoadFocus s'intègre parfaitement pour fournir une surveillance en temps réel, des alertes et une analyse détaillée tout au long du processus de test.
Composants clés
1. Simulation de trafic
Simulez des flux de trafic et des modèles d'utilisation du monde réel, du trafic lent aux pics soudains, pour voir comment votre CDN fonctionne sous différentes conditions de charge.
2. Simulation d'utilisateurs virtuels
Configurez des milliers d'utilisateurs simultanés pour tester comment votre CDN gère les pics de trafic dans plusieurs régions. Avec LoadFocus, vous pouvez adapter vos tests pour correspondre aux scénarios de charge de pointe attendus.
3. Suivi des métriques de performance
Suivez des métriques critiques telles que la disponibilité, le temps de réponse et les taux d'erreur. Ce modèle vous aide à identifier d'éventuels problèmes de performance qui pourraient affecter l'expérience utilisateur.
4. Alertes et notifications
Configurez des alertes en temps réel pour être informé de toute interruption de service, problème de latence ou goulet d'étranglement de performance pendant les tests.
5. Analyse des résultats
Une fois les tests terminés, utilisez les rapports LoadFocus pour identifier les problèmes et les domaines à améliorer, vous aidant à optimiser les performances de votre CDN.
Visualisation des tests de disponibilité
Imaginez un scénario où des utilisateurs du monde entier demandent du contenu simultanément. Ce modèle vous montre comment les visualisations LoadFocus fournissent des informations détaillées sur la performance du CDN, mettant en évidence la disponibilité, les temps d'arrêt et les temps de réponse.
Quels types de tests de disponibilité existe-t-il ?
Ce modèle couvre une variété de méthodes de test de disponibilité pour garantir que votre CDN fonctionne bien sous des conditions de charge moyennes et élevées :
Tests de stress
Poussez votre CDN au-delà de l'utilisation typique pour découvrir des faiblesses et identifier des goulets d'étranglement de performance.
Tests de pics
Simulez des pics soudains de trafic utilisateur, comme lors de lancements de produits ou d'événements spéciaux, pour tester la capacité de votre CDN à évoluer rapidement.
Tests d'endurance
Simulez des périodes prolongées de trafic intense pour tester comment votre CDN gère une charge prolongée et identifier les problèmes qui peuvent survenir lors d'une utilisation continue élevée.
Tests de scalabilité
Augmentez progressivement la charge utilisateur pour évaluer comment votre CDN évolue et répond à la demande croissante au fil du temps.
Tests de volume
Testez la capacité de votre CDN à gérer de grands volumes de demandes de données dans plusieurs régions, garantissant des performances constantes sous un trafic important.
Cadres de test de charge pour les CDN
Bien que d'autres outils de test comme JMeter ou Gatling puissent être adaptés pour les tests de CDN, LoadFocus excelle à simplifier la configuration des tests, la scalabilité et la distribution mondiale, fournissant des informations précises sur la performance du CDN depuis plusieurs régions.
Surveillance de vos tests de disponibilité
La surveillance en temps réel est cruciale lors des tests de disponibilité. LoadFocus fournit des tableaux de bord en direct qui suivent des métriques de performance telles que la disponibilité, les temps de réponse et les taux d'erreur, vous permettant de repérer tout problème au fur et à mesure qu'il survient et d'agir immédiatement.
L'importance de ce modèle pour les performances de votre CDN
Les tests de disponibilité garantissent que votre CDN peut fournir un service ininterrompu même pendant les pics de demande. En utilisant ce modèle, vous pouvez identifier les points faibles potentiels et optimiser votre infrastructure CDN pour une disponibilité et des performances maximales.
Métriques critiques à suivre
- Disponibilité : Mesurez la disponibilité de votre CDN et suivez tout temps d'arrêt ou interruption de service.
- Temps de réponse : Surveillez la rapidité avec laquelle votre CDN livre du contenu sous différentes conditions de charge.
- Taux d'erreur : Suivez la fréquence des erreurs, telles que les 404 ou les erreurs de délai d'attente, pour identifier d'éventuels problèmes avec votre CDN.
- Utilisation des ressources : Surveillez l'utilisation du CPU, de la mémoire et de la bande passante pour garantir une gestion efficace des ressources pendant les périodes de fort trafic.
Quelles sont les meilleures pratiques pour ce modèle ?
- Tester depuis plusieurs régions : Profitez de LoadFocus pour simuler un trafic provenant de plus de 26 régions cloud afin d'obtenir une image fidèle des performances du CDN à l'échelle mondiale.
- Simuler un trafic du monde réel : Assurez-vous que vos tests reflètent le comportement typique des utilisateurs et les conditions du monde réel, y compris les pics de trafic et les charges élevées de longue durée.
- Suivre en continu les performances du CDN : Utilisez des tests de disponibilité continus pour surveiller les performances de votre CDN et détecter les problèmes tôt.
- Impliquer votre équipe de développement : Partagez les résultats avec les développeurs et les équipes opérationnelles pour résoudre les problèmes potentiels avant qu'ils n'affectent les utilisateurs.
Avantages de l'utilisation de ce modèle
Détection précoce des problèmes
Identifiez les problèmes de performance et les temps d'arrêt potentiels avant qu'ils n'affectent les utilisateurs, garantissant une haute disponibilité pour vos clients.
Optimisation des performances
Optimisez les performances de votre CDN en identifiant les goulets d'étranglement et en les abordant de manière proactive pour améliorer les temps de réponse et l'utilisation des ressources.
Assurer la disponibilité mondiale
Assurez-vous que votre CDN peut gérer de grands volumes de trafic mondial sans affecter la disponibilité ou l'expérience utilisateur.
Maintenance proactive
Maintenez des performances optimales en testant continuellement votre infrastructure CDN et en résolvant les problèmes avant qu'ils ne deviennent critiques.
Tests de disponibilité continus – Le besoin permanent
Les tests de disponibilité ne sont pas une tâche ponctuelle. À mesure que les modèles de trafic changent et que votre infrastructure CDN évolue, des tests continus garantissent que votre système reste hautement disponible et performant. Ce modèle souligne l'importance des tests de disponibilité continus pour maintenir des performances optimales.
Disponibilité constante
Effectuez régulièrement des tests de disponibilité pour vous assurer que votre CDN peut gérer la demande croissante des utilisateurs sans interruptions de service.
Résolution proactive des problèmes
Repérez les problèmes potentiels avant qu'ils n'impactent les utilisateurs et prenez des mesures pour prévenir les interruptions de service.
Validation des performances
Utilisez des tests fréquents pour valider les améliorations et garantir que les nouvelles modifications apportées à votre infrastructure CDN n'affectent pas les performances.
Cas d'utilisation des tests de disponibilité pour les CDN
Ce modèle est idéal pour les entreprises s'appuyant sur des CDN pour livrer du contenu de manière efficace et fiable :
Fournisseurs de contenu
- Services de streaming : Assurez un streaming ininterrompu de contenu vidéo pendant les périodes de forte audience.
- Sites web médiatiques : Testez les performances du CDN pour les sites d'actualités ou les blogs connaissant des pics de trafic soudains.
Sites de commerce électronique
- Lancements de produits : Testez comment votre CDN gère l'augmentation du trafic lors des lancements de produits ou des ventes.
- Ventes saisonnières : Assurez une haute disponibilité pendant les événements de vente majeurs comme le Black Friday ou le Cyber Monday.
Applications cloud
- Livraison de logiciels mondiaux : Assurez-vous que les téléchargements et mises à jour de votre application sont livrés de manière fiable à travers le monde.
Commencer avec ce modèle
Pour commencer, importez ce modèle dans votre projet LoadFocus. Configurez vos scénarios de test de charge, ajustez les niveaux de charge et commencez à simuler du trafic pour évaluer la disponibilité et les performances de votre CDN.
Pourquoi utiliser LoadFocus avec ce modèle ?
- Plusieurs régions cloud : Testez depuis plus de 26 régions cloud pour capturer un large éventail de données de performance à l'échelle mondiale.
- Scalabilité : Simulez facilement des milliers d'utilisateurs simultanés pour évaluer comment votre CDN évolue sous une charge de pointe.
- Informations en temps réel : Obtenez des analyses détaillées et en temps réel sur la disponibilité, les performances et la santé du système tout au long de vos tests.
- Surveillance continue : Intégrez les tests de disponibilité dans vos flux de travail de surveillance réguliers pour garantir des performances et une disponibilité continues.
Dernières réflexions
Ce modèle garantit que votre CDN maintient une haute disponibilité et des performances optimales même sous une charge importante. En utilisant LoadFocus Load Testing, vous pouvez surveiller et tester en continu la disponibilité de votre CDN, réduisant le risque d'interruptions de service et améliorant l'expérience utilisateur globale.
FAQ sur les tests de disponibilité pour les CDN
Quel est l'objectif des tests de disponibilité pour les CDN ?
Ils aident à confirmer que votre CDN peut gérer de grands volumes de trafic sans temps d'arrêt, garantissant une livraison de contenu fiable.
À quelle fréquence devrais-je exécuter des tests de disponibilité ?
Les tests de disponibilité doivent être exécutés régulièrement, surtout lorsque vous faites évoluer votre CDN, ajoutez de nouvelles régions ou déployez du nouveau contenu.
Puis-je personnaliser le modèle pour différents fournisseurs de CDN ?
Oui, ce modèle peut être personnalisé pour correspondre à l'architecture et à la configuration spécifiques de votre fournisseur de CDN.
Quelles métriques devrais-je suivre lors des tests de disponibilité ?
Les métriques importantes incluent la disponibilité, le temps de réponse, le taux d'erreur et l'utilisation des ressources dans diverses régions.
Comment LoadFocus soutient-il les tests de disponibilité pour les CDN ?
LoadFocus vous aide à simuler un trafic mondial réaliste, à surveiller les performances du CDN en temps réel et à générer des rapports détaillés pour améliorer la fiabilité et la disponibilité de votre CDN.
```Quelle est la vitesse de votre site web?
Augmentez sa vitesse et son référencement naturel de manière transparente avec notre Test de Vitesse gratuit.Vous méritez de meilleurs services de test
Donnez du pouvoir à votre expérience numérique ! Plateforme cloud complète et conviviale pour le test et le monitoring de charge et de vitesse.Commencez à tester maintenant→